Hi, no problem, dimensions in attachment, but... I do not count turns. I remember Tx was like 39-40, but Rx I do not know, between 170-180 turns, but I rather measure inductance. And I do not use the 328p tester which is in video, it measure inductance around 1mH well, but lies a lot around 14mH (it shows around 19mH on 14,7mH coil...). Use KT315 coil tester or plane oscilator and calculate inductance from known frequency and capacitor.
